Tough Day to Play Two: Tourists Drop a Pair

May 27, 2018 - South Atlantic League (SAL1)
Asheville Tourists News Release


ASHEVILLE - The Lexington Legends swept a double-head from the Asheville Tourists on Sunday night. Lexington held on to with the first game 5-4 and took the back end from Asheville 5-3.

The Tourists built a 3-1 lead in game one of the double header but the Legends used a three-run fourth inning to take a 4-3 lead. After the Legends added an insurance run, Asheville received an RBI double by Taylor Snyder in the bottom of the seventh that brought the Tourists to within one. Unfortunately, Snyder was left at second base to end the game.

In game two, Lexington held Asheville's offense to one first inning run while the Legends tallied a 5-1 advantage heading to the sixth. Casey Golden hit an RBI single and Ramon Marcelino picked up an RBI groundout. The Tourists never came any closer.

Asheville totaled 13 hits in the two games and Bret Boswell was responsible for five of them. Boswell went 3-for-4 in game one and 2-for-3 in game two. Boswell has reached base in 18 straight games and his current 16-game home hitting streak is the longest streak for any player in the South Atlantic League this season.

Asheville and Lexington wrap up their five-game series on Monday afternoon with a 1:05pm first pitch.
